Jamshedpur FC signs Serbian international Alen Stevanovic on a two-year deal

Jamshedpur, July 18: Jamshedpur FC have completed the signing of Serbian international Alen Stevanovic on a two-year contract ahead of the 2023-24 season.

The 32-year-old playmaker has enjoyed a glittering career so far, starting out with the Inter Milan youth team in Italy, and being handed his debut in the senior team by current AS Roma Head Coach, Jose Mourinho.

Stevanovic was a part of the Inter squad that won the treble in 2009-10 under Mourinho, with the club lifting the Serie A Scudetto, Coppa Italia and UEFA Champions League winners trophies.

A successful spell in Italian football continued for the Swiss-born Serbian, as he played for the likes of Torino FC, Palermo, SSC Bari and Spezia.

“It’s an honour for me to be a part of Jamshedpur FC. I have heard a lot about the club and its fans and I’m excited to finally come to the city and play,” Alen Stevanovic said after joining Jamshedpur FC last evening.

A perennial winner, Alen lifted the Serie B crown at Palermo and enjoyed Serbian Super Liga (2016-17) and Serbian Cup (2015-16, 2016-17) triumphs at Partizan Belgrade and has also represented the Serbian National Team on multiple occasions at the World Cup Qualifiers. Most recently, he led FK IMT to the Serbian First League trophy in the 2022-23 season

Known for his silky touch and ability to see passes that others would miss, Stevanovic has all the qualities needed to bring more goals to the Jamshedpur FC tally.

“Alen is a phenomenal signing for Jamshedpur FC,” commented the head coach, Scott Cooper.
